Evidence and safety

Do not open recovered attachments or links on SUSA. Preserve the source store and exported-message provenance. Record the input identifier, tool version, relevant commands or settings, time and time zone, output location, and any errors or limitations as you work.

Accessing Kernel OST Viewer in SUSA

Kernel OST Viewer is a tool used to open and view Outlook OST files without needing Microsoft Outlook or an Exchange connection.

Move the downloaded executable to C:\Tools\Kernel OST Viewer directory and double-click the application. Click Next, accept the license agreement. Select default options and click Next.

Once the install is complete, click Finish.

This creates a desktop shortcut and launches the application.

Right-click the Kernel OST Viewer desktop shortcut and select Properties. Record the application location (C:\Program Files (x86)\Kernel OST Viewer\Kernel OST Viewer.exe).

Move the shortcut to C:\Tools\Kernel OST Viewer.

Double-click Kernel OST Viewer to verify that it runs without an error.
